Chapter 101 The family should be all together.
After entering the house, the old man invited the proprietress to sit at the head of the table above the fire pit, served her the best Mengding Mountain tea in the house, and also laid out four kinds of tea snacks, showing his sincerity.
Once the old man makes up his mind, his execution is top-notch!
The proprietress was even more impressive; after taking a couple of sips of tea, she presented eight carefully prepared birthday gifts.
Locally, birthday gifts typically consist of eight items, known as "Eight Immortals Celebrating Longevity," which is considered the most grand birthday gift.
The first item was a set of dark blue cotton clothes from Songjiang, which was perfect for the old man to wear in the autumn.
"Wow, it even has a hidden floral pattern!" Su Daji volunteered to speak for the proprietress, saying, "Such fine Songjiang fabric, even Sixth Brother didn't wear it when he was a centurion, did he?"
"Never worn it." The old man played along, unlike his usual sharp-tongued self, not saying anything like "show-off"...
The second item was a pair of satin shoes with cloud patterns on the soles, decorated with ruyi-shaped ornaments on the toes and ruyi-shaped clouds on the heels.
"Wow, these shoes are really high-class. Only someone like you who used to be an official could wear them. They're not suitable for us ordinary people," Su Daji immediately praised.
"Never worn it..." the old man said.
The third item is a mahogany walking stick carved with pine and crane patterns.
This naturally drew admiring glances from Su Daji: "Is this dragon-taming wood? Let me try it? The weight is just right, and it's neither too light nor too heavy. It's neither too cold nor too hot to hold. It truly deserves to be the best walking stick! Wear this and take a stroll with this stick, and even the old men of Erlangtan will envy you!"
"Never worn it..." The old man realized his mistake after saying that and glared at his seventh brother.
"Don't make a fuss, you look so ignorant!"
"I've never seen it before..." Su Daji chuckled awkwardly. His most important job right now was to appease the landlady and make sure she wouldn't return to the Cheng family. For this, he'd do anything, from playing the straight man to flattering her.
So the remaining five gifts—one pound of donkey-hide gelatin from Shandong, two pounds of Mengding Mountain tea, two packets of osmanthus shortbread, one brass hand warmer, and one packet of amla fruit from Yunnan—still received the utmost praise from Master Su.
Of course, it wasn't just Su Daji's exaggerated praise; the gift truly touched the old man's heart. Especially the packet of dried and sliced amla berries, which he had been craving for a long time. On the spot, he couldn't resist pairing them with some dogwood and wrapping them in betel leaves.
It's so addictive, you get hooked after just one bite, and the more you chew, the more addictive it becomes...
"Alright, alright, my dear, you've gone to so much trouble. I'll accept your kind gesture this time. Just come empty-handed next time, don't bring anything." The old man squinted, looking completely smug, whether from the tuft of leaves or from the landlady's coaxing, it was hard to tell.
“No way. I didn’t have any money before, so I couldn’t afford to support my father. Now that I’m finally a little better off, I have to make up for what I missed.” The proprietress is so eloquent, and she’s also willing to spend money.
Then he presented gifts to the old lady, the eldest uncle, the eldest sister-in-law, Chun-ge, and Jin-bao, all of which were very thoughtful and charming, making the women feel completely smitten.
Without an inside traitor, it would never have been delivered so perfectly...
It was still early, and seeing the family all happy and harmonious, Su Daji felt relieved and took his leave. The distillery was bustling with activity, and he couldn't possibly spend the whole afternoon there.
"Come early for drinks tonight." The old man saw him to the stairwell.
"It's hard to say on other days, but I'll definitely be here early tonight." Su Daji laughed and walked away with his hands behind his back. He was now certain that even if Cheng Xiucai intervened, he wouldn't be able to persuade the landlady to come back.

With no outsiders in the house, the proprietress smiled and said, "There's something important I haven't mentioned yet. Our Sweet Water Restaurant has been open for half a year now, and the business is doing quite well. I've brought the dividends home."
"Didn't we agree to split the profits at the end of the year? It's only been half a year, what's the rush?" the uncle said insincerely.
"Rules are made by people, and we still give the monthly share to Commander Ma, don't we?" the proprietress laughed. "My family isn't well-off, but the money is just lying in the account doing nothing. How can I bear to see that?"
Su Youcai also said, "Brother, the landlady has her own arrangements, we just need to listen to them."
"Alright, then I won't be polite." The uncle rubbed his hands together excitedly.
"New goods were available every month during the first half of the year, so sales were consistently strong, and by the end of June, we had made a total profit of one hundred and fifty taels." The proprietress showed the account books to the shareholders and continued:
"Of this, Commander Ma should receive thirty taels, and his family should receive twenty-four taels. However, Commander Ma also has an extra allowance, which will be given to whoever becomes commander, and will be gone once he steps down. I will pay for it, so you don't need to worry about it."
This was all agreed upon beforehand, so naturally no one had any objections.
"In addition, we need to sell Erlang wine in the second half of the year, which will require a fee. So let's give the family twenty taels this time." With that, the godmother handed a heavy bundle of silver to her eldest aunt.
Auntie hadn't touched so much silver in at least ten years. Her hands trembled with excitement, and her voice trembled as she exclaimed, "They only opened in February, and they've already made this much in just five months? They'll get forty or fifty taels a year! Hahahaha..."
"There won't be as many kinds of fruit in the second half of the year, so sales will definitely decline," the proprietress said with a smile. "However, if our Erlang wine can successfully open up the market, then the year-end bonus will only be more, not less."
"Oh dear, sister. We haven't done anything, how can we accept so much money?" The aunt, though simple-minded, had no ill intentions whatsoever. "Why don't you take half back? Otherwise, it's too much of a rip-off for you..."
"Sister-in-law, you don't know, but I'm all alone. My business was started entirely thanks to my second brother, eldest brother, and two good sons." The godmother shook her head and took Su Lu's hand, saying, "Even now, Qiu-ge'er still has to make all the decisions for me. If we're talking about who's getting the better deal, I'm the one who's really getting the better deal."
"We're all family, there's no such thing as taking advantage," Su Youcai said with a smile, waving his hand. Actually, the landlady still paid him a monthly wage...
"Absolutely, absolutely, Second Brother is absolutely right." The proprietress nodded hurriedly and said, "In the end, doesn't all the money we earn still belong to our children?"
“Yes, yes, we’re family. From now on, you’re my little sister!” Aunt nodded vigorously, excitedly stuffing the silver into Uncle’s hand, tying on her apron and saying, “Little sister, wait for me, I’ll go make you something delicious.”
The old man rolled his eyes. "Who the hell has a birthday?" But that's just how his aunt is, so he didn't bother arguing with her.
The old lady, who had been all smiles and hadn't heard anything, suddenly said, "Eldest daughter-in-law, can we eat less sorghum flour from now on?"
"Don't worry, Mother, we'll switch to eating rice and noodles from now on!" Auntie waved her hand and said boldly.
Two-grain flour is a type of mixed grain flour, which can be combined in various ways. You can use bean flour with sorghum flour, or millet flour with... Sorghum flour is certainly not as good as pure wheat flour and rice, but in terms of both taste and nutrition, it is superior to single sorghum flour, buckwheat flour and other whole grains.
The key is that it helps with fertilization...
"Sister-in-law, let me help you." Seeing that her aunt was going to cook, the godmother also volunteered.
"No need, no need, you can just sit and have some tea." Auntie waved her hand and said, "I don't like people making things difficult when I'm cooking, I can finish faster without you..."
"Ah..." The godmother was taken aback, thinking to herself, "Why is she insulting me like this?"
"Your sister-in-law just talks nonsense, you'll get used to it," the uncle explained with a wry smile.
“But Auntie has a good heart,” Su Lu added, helping to explain.
"Oh, it's nothing, it's nothing." Godmother quickly smiled and said, "A straightforward temper is a good thing. That's just the kind of person I am. People like us don't have bad intentions."

My aunt originally planned to have six dishes and a soup tonight. But in her excitement, she upgraded it to ten dishes and two soups!
And it didn't delay the start of the banquet at all.
In addition, the ingredients for this meal were all sourced by my uncle from the town...
As dusk fell, the main room was brightly lit, and an eight-immortal table was set up, laden with large plates and bowls!
The birthday celebrant put on a brand-new Songjiang-style robe with a dark floral pattern and the character for longevity. Looking at the sumptuous meal on the table, he was filled with emotion.
Over the years, the family has fallen on hard times. When he and his mother celebrate their birthdays, they have a bowl of longevity noodles with eggs, a stir-fried pickled radish with cured meat, and two river fish caught by Xia Ge'er. That is considered a very lavish meal.
On this day last year, Qiu Ge'er was carried back home. No one in the family was in the mood to eat. His daughter-in-law finally made him a bowl of noodles in the middle of the night, and he managed to eat a couple of bites to celebrate his birthday.
Let's see what happens this year!
In the center of the octagonal table sits a large bowl of Dongpo pork, with neat, square pieces of three-layered pork belly, glistening with tempting oil!
On the long plate next to it is a whole steamed mandarin fish. The fish has been scored with beautiful cuts, sprinkled with shredded ginger, drizzled with hot oil, and finally drizzled with soy sauce. It looks so appealing!
Surrounding the two main dishes were the braised pig's trotters that the old lady had been longing for, the eight-treasure duck brought by the proprietress, a large plate of salt and pepper river shrimp, and fragrant celery stir-fried with shredded pork...
Even the vegetarian dishes have been upgraded. The usual simple stir-fried bok choy is now being stir-fried with soaked shiitake mushrooms. And the stir-fried tofu with scallions has been transformed into shrimp and tofu!
At this moment, Chun Ge'er and Xia Ge'er have both returned from work, and the old clan chief and Su Daji have also come to celebrate the old brother's birthday.
But the old man kept staring at the door, and as time went by, he became more and more restless.
He only showed a genuine smile when his uncle and aunt appeared at the door, looking travel-worn.
"Auntie!" Little Jinbao, who had been drooling over the food on the table, suddenly leaped into the air.
"Auntie." Su Lu and Su Tai also quickly stood up. They hadn't seen their aunt who raised them for half a year, so they naturally missed her terribly.
The aunt hugged the three children excitedly, saying that nowhere is as good as home!
Seeing that none of the children greeted him, the uncle awkwardly approached the elders, first paying his respects to the old clan chief and his seventh uncle, and then presenting his father with a birthday gift.
The old man then turned stern and said, "Why are you two only getting back now?!"
"Old man," the uncle immediately complained, "the Chishui River isn't even open for navigation yet. My sister and I set off early yesterday morning, and the donkey was exhausted, let alone us!"
"If it's hard to walk, then don't come back," the old man said with heartache.
"How could I possibly miss it? It's Dad's birthday, I can't be absent even if it means going through fire and water!" the uncle quickly patted his chest and said.
"Hmph, sweet talk, hurry up and wash up, let's start the feast." The old man patted his youngest son's cheek and said.
"Hey." The younger uncle quickly went out to wash up and change into clean clothes.
